Ways To Get Blog Comments Outside WA

Like I said, it is still possible to get comments if you're hosted outside WA. These are some ways to get them:

  1. Ask your friends and relatives to comment on your blog posts
  2. Become super good at writing content so you get comments from legit readers
  3. Join Facebook groups created for blog posts syndication
  4. Open your blog commenting system to spammers

To me, it's only #2 that I like. Others, forget them.

I remember, prior to discovering WA I was already blogging for the MLM niche.

The way to get comments then was to join blog post syndication groups in Facebook, give comments to 3 blog posts before you can request those 3 people to give comments to yours.

Oftentimes, not all of them reciprocates.

Then, I'll check the comments Que to find spam comments to edit and make them look like legit. (Yes, you can edit them and disable the spam links)

WA's Site Comments


Here, you just give 2 comments to generate the credit needed for requesting 1 comment.

The system requires the person commenting to really read the blog post or else the comment that will be screened out will not pass through our system's strict "uniqueness verification" method.

Truly legit comments.

And like I said, just give 2 comments and you'll get 1 in return via your credits. It's super easy to have people commenting on your blog posts.
